Commitment to Achieving Net Zero

We Care You Plus is committed to reducing its environmental impact and supporting the UK and Welsh Government commitment to achieve Net Zero greenhouse gas emissions by 2050.


As a provider of domiciliary care services, we recognise that our primary environmental impact arises from staff travel between service users’ homes, office energy usage and administrative operations.


We Care You Plus is committed to continuously reviewing operational practices and implementing measures that will reduce our carbon footprint while maintaining high-quality and reliable care services.

Baseline Emissions Footprint

Baseline emissions represent the greenhouse gases produced prior to the introduction of carbon reduction initiatives and provide a reference point against which emissions reductions can be measured.
As a small domiciliary care provider, detailed carbon measurement systems are currently being developed. However, our primary emission sources have been identified as staff travel, electricity usage and operational activities

Completed Carbon Reduction Initiatives

Project Scope Details
Digital Care Records
Scope 3
Implementation of electronic care systems to reduce paper use
Efficient Rota Planning
Scope 3
Staff rotas organised to minimise travel distances
Energy – Efficient Lighting
Scope 2
Use of energy-efficient lighting and equipment in office operations
Recycling Practices
Scope 3
Recycling systems implemented for paper and office waste
